Party affiliation among Mainline Protestants who attend religious services at least once a week by religious group (2014) Switch to: Religious family among Mainline Protestants who attend religious services at least once a week by political party
% of Mainline Protestants who attend religious services at least once a week who identify as…
| Religious family | Republican/lean Rep. | No lean | Democrat/lean Dem. | Sample size |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Baptist Family (Mainline Trad.) | 38% | 15% | 47% | 246 |
| Congregationalist Family (Mainline Trad.) | 32% | 7% | 61% | 101 |
| Episcopalian/Anglican Family (Mainline Trad.) | 41% | 11% | 47% | 223 |
| Lutheran Family (Mainline Trad.) | 42% | 15% | 43% | 292 |
| Methodist Family (Mainline Trad.) | 55% | 12% | 32% | 778 |
| Nonspecific Protestant Family (Mainline Trad.) | 30% | 39% | 31% | 108 |
| Presbyterian Family (Mainline Trad.) | 44% | 10% | 46% | 251 |
